## Step 3: Point tailfox at the new broker

If your plugin still shells out to the old `tailfox stream` command, heads up: it's gone in v4. The Quillhaven team replaced it with `tailfox follow`, which speaks the new framing protocol and won't silently drop multiline entries anymore. Update your plugin manifest first, then rebuild against the v4 SDK. Before testing, make sure your local broker settings match the values below.

settings of fafog-haduf:
ZORIX_PIN=4648
ZORIX_METRICS_HOST=metrics.zorix.paliqsys.corp
ZORIX_LOG_LEVEL=info
ZORIX_TENANT=druix

Heads up for eng sync: the Quillway query planner regression (v4.8) is blocked because our perf-baseline vault locked itself after the Thornley cluster reboot. Can't pull the pre-regression plan snapshots until it's open again, so bisecting is stalled. The planner is still picking nested-loop joins on the Merrow tables — roughly 6x slower. Once we unlock the vault we can diff plans and likely revert one cost-model commit. Whoever grabs this first, open the vault with the passphrase below.

recovery phrase for fajep-yaweg: gilath-sorox-wenius-rusdor-keliel-zorius

Runbook: Vantol retention sweeper. Runs hourly via the Pexley scheduler. Deletes records past policy age in batches of 5k; throttles if replica lag exceeds 10s. If sweep stalls: check the lease table for a stuck holder, clear it, restart the worker. Never run two sweepers against the same shard. Dry-run mode: set SWEEP_DRYRUN=1 and diff counts before enabling deletes. Escalate to the Dataworks rotation if tombstone backlog exceeds one million rows. The full playbook with query snippets lives at the page below.

dashboard of yafog-fajof = https://jira.tolvaqsys.internal/pages/pages/projects/49fe21c4